amp_1356
یک شنبه 18 بهمن 1394, 17:23 عصر
سلام
من یه فرم دارم که اطلاعات رو از بانک mysql می گیره و داخل جدول نشون میده. حالا مشکلم اینه که اولین رکورد رو نمایش نمیده و یا وقتی با کوئری جستجو می نم که نتیجه اون فقط یک رکورد هست، اصلا چیزی نمایش نمی ده.
اگر ممکنه کمک کنید. ممنون
$servername = "localhost";$username = "root";
$password = "";
$dbname = "mydb";
// Create connection
$conn = mysql_connect($servername, $username, $password)
or die("Unable to connect to MySQL");
// Check connection
mysql_select_db($dbname,$conn);
mysql_query('SET NAMES \'utf8\'');
mysql_query('mysql_set_charset("utf8")');
$sql = 'SELECT id, nam FROM tb1';
$result = mysql_query($sql);
if ($row = mysql_fetch_array($result)>0) {
$i = 1;
$t = '<table>
<th>ردیف</th><th>کد</th><th class="a">نام</th>';
// output data of each row
while($row = mysql_fetch_array($result)) {
$t .= '<tr><td id="d">'.$i.'</td><td>'.$row["id"].'</td><td>'.$row["nam"].'</td></tr>';
$i++;
}
$t .= '</table>';
echo $t.'<style>
#d{background-color:#33ccff;}</style>';
mysql_free_result($result);
} else {
echo "پیدا نشد";
}
mysql_close($conn);
}else{
echo "پیدا نشد";
}
من یه فرم دارم که اطلاعات رو از بانک mysql می گیره و داخل جدول نشون میده. حالا مشکلم اینه که اولین رکورد رو نمایش نمیده و یا وقتی با کوئری جستجو می نم که نتیجه اون فقط یک رکورد هست، اصلا چیزی نمایش نمی ده.
اگر ممکنه کمک کنید. ممنون
$servername = "localhost";$username = "root";
$password = "";
$dbname = "mydb";
// Create connection
$conn = mysql_connect($servername, $username, $password)
or die("Unable to connect to MySQL");
// Check connection
mysql_select_db($dbname,$conn);
mysql_query('SET NAMES \'utf8\'');
mysql_query('mysql_set_charset("utf8")');
$sql = 'SELECT id, nam FROM tb1';
$result = mysql_query($sql);
if ($row = mysql_fetch_array($result)>0) {
$i = 1;
$t = '<table>
<th>ردیف</th><th>کد</th><th class="a">نام</th>';
// output data of each row
while($row = mysql_fetch_array($result)) {
$t .= '<tr><td id="d">'.$i.'</td><td>'.$row["id"].'</td><td>'.$row["nam"].'</td></tr>';
$i++;
}
$t .= '</table>';
echo $t.'<style>
#d{background-color:#33ccff;}</style>';
mysql_free_result($result);
} else {
echo "پیدا نشد";
}
mysql_close($conn);
}else{
echo "پیدا نشد";
}